Austrian Airlines Suspends Flights to Iran
Austrian Airlines has decided to suspend flights to Iran until January 12, 2026, citing safety concerns, according to Austrian Wings magazine, referencing a spokesperson for the airline.
“The safety department of Austrian Airlines, in coordination with the Group Security Department, has advised as a precautionary measure to suspend flights to and from Tehran through January 12, 2026, based on the current assessment of the situation,” the spokesperson told the publication.
It is noted that a decision regarding the potential resumption of regular flights to Tehran after January 13 will be made later, following further assessment of the situation.
